Max factor Miracle pure skin reset 2 in one serum foundation
Max Factor’s Miracle Pure 2-in-1 Serum Foundation is designed to offer more than just coverage. As the name suggests, it’s a combination of a serum and foundation, blending skincare ingredients with makeup to help enhance the complexion over time.

6 Amazing foundations for dry and mature skin
If you have dry or mature (or both) skin you probably experience some difficulties in finding a really nice foundation or BB cream. The struggles might be that the product settles in your lines or clings to dry patches. Or if you have really dry skin like me, you might experience discomfort in using facial makeup. But that doesn't mean that there isn't a product for you out there it just means that you haven't found it yet.
